Sheida Sangtarash (born 21 April 1984) is a Norwegian politician for the Socialist Left Party.

Sangtarash migrated to Norway from Iran as a teenager. In 2015, she was elected to Bærum municipal council.[1][2] She served as a deputy representative to the Parliament of Norway from Akershus during the term 2017–2021.[3]
